That LG Voyager on Verizon’s network just got a little more iPhone-like. Visual voicemail is now appearing on the VZW website and that means you can have it appear on your Voyager handset too. The product page shows that the application will cost you $0.00 for a monthly fee and $0.00 on a per use basis. Sounds good, but I haven’t seen an official announcement for the service just yet so those zeros might change on us.
Aside from the basics that visual voicemail offers, I see some nice features in this implementation:
- Save up to 40 messages for 40 days, or archive them permanently.
- Create 10 different caller-ID based greetings.
- Reply via Voice Mail, text, picture or video messaging.
- Forward via Voice Mail, text or picture messaging
While the product page shows that only the Voyager is supported, it wouldn’t surprise me to see this app eventually working its way on to some of the newer LG phones soon. You know… like the Dare and the Decoy that James is looking at.
